Rubber roof installation involves applying a durable, flexible membrane made from synthetic rubber materials, such as EPDM, over the existing roofing surface or on new structures. This process typically includes preparing the roof deck, ensuring a clean and smooth surface, then carefully installing the rubber membrane and sealing all seams to create a watertight barrier. The goal is to provide a long-lasting roof that can withstand the elements while requiring minimal maintenance over time. Experienced contractors use specialized techniques and quality materials to ensure the installation is secure and effective, helping property owners protect their investment.

This service is especially beneficial for addressing common roofing problems like leaks, cracks, and weather-related damage. Rubber roofs are highly resistant to water infiltration, making them a popular choice for flat or low-slope roofs prone to pooling water. Installing a rubber roof can help prevent costly water damage inside the property, such as mold growth or structural deterioration. Additionally, rubber roofing can accommodate minor shifts or movements in the building’s structure without cracking, which helps extend the lifespan of the roof and reduces the need for frequent repairs.

Properties that typically use rubber roof installation include commercial bu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ities, but many homeowners also choose this option for their flat or low-slope roofs. Residential properties with extensive deck areas, patios, or flat roof sections often benefit from rubber roofing because of its durability and ease of maintenance. It’s also suitable for structures where traditional asphalt shingles are less effective or where a seamless, waterproof surface is desired. What are the benefits of installing a rubber roof? Rubber roofs are known for durability, flexibility, and resistance to weathering, making them a popular choice for many property owners in East Orange, NJ.

How long does a rubber roof installation typically last? While specific lifespans can vary, rubber roofs generally provide reliable protection for 20 to 30 years when properly installed by experienced contractors.

What types of buildings are suitable for rubber roof installation? Rubber roofing can be installed on a variety of structures,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and flat roof designs common in East Orange, NJ.

What preparation is needed before a rubber roof installation? Proper surface cleaning and inspection are essential to ensure the roof deck is in good condition, allowing local contractors to prepare the area effectively for installation.
